Commit Graph

324 Commits

Author SHA1 Message Date
Anthony Leonardo Gracio
b2384dfebb Fix style errors (no-tn-check) 2022-12-21 17:16:46 +01:00
Vadim Godunko
5bc8ae7308 Merge branch 'topic/io' into 'master'
text stream file output

See merge request eng/ide/VSS!207
2022-12-14 09:13:48 +00:00
Vadim Godunko
a1a3819d0b Virtual_String_Encoder.Reset_State 2022-12-12 12:52:39 +03:00
Vadim Godunko
92b0b45078 Add constructors for word iterator.
Reuse these constructors in VSS.Strings.
2022-11-28 17:29:13 +03:00
Vadim Godunko
b61450727a Provide constructors of line iterator.
Reuse these constructors in VSS.Strings.
2022-11-28 17:29:13 +03:00
Vadim Godunko
a26583350b Add constructors of grapheme cluser iterator.
Reuse these constructors in VSS.Strings.
2022-11-28 17:29:13 +03:00
Vadim Godunko
12c8be9a9f U310-022 Subprograms to update content of Wide_Wide_String. 2022-10-17 14:31:30 +03:00
Vadim Godunko
f5d4f5f7ee V805-018 KOI8-R decoder 2022-10-15 20:55:50 +03:00
Vadim Godunko
4f98dc15fe V805-018 Improve handling of ASCII characters by Japanese decoders 2022-10-15 20:55:50 +03:00
Vadim Godunko
d661c71d02 V805-018 Shift-JIS decoder 2022-10-15 20:55:50 +03:00
Vadim Godunko
5ce575ffa3 Minor reformatting. 2022-10-15 20:55:50 +03:00
Vadim Godunko
298c9cdf15 Rename file to reuse by EUC-JP and Shift-JIS decoders. 2022-10-15 20:55:50 +03:00
Vadim Godunko
f64cfe5903 V805-018 EUC-JP decoder implementation. 2022-10-15 20:55:50 +03:00
Vadim Godunko
b3c412a73a Move declaration of ASCII_Byte_Range to allow to reuse it 2022-10-15 20:55:50 +03:00
Vadim Godunko
bac5fe6d0e V805-018 Decoder for GB18030 set of encodings. 2022-10-15 20:55:50 +03:00
Vadim Godunko
baa9684e6c Clarify description of Decode subprogram and simplify code. 2022-10-15 20:55:50 +03:00
Vadim Godunko
90a1f1a4c1 Fix typo. 2022-10-15 20:55:50 +03:00
Vadim Godunko
574342c9a9 Rewrite if statement as expression. 2022-10-15 20:55:50 +03:00
Vadim Godunko
e8c1430579 V805-018 Enhance decoder to handle incomplete multibyte sequence...
... at the end of the data.
2022-10-15 20:55:50 +03:00
Vadim Godunko
d51ef3cc76 V805-018 Decoder of ISO-8859-15 2022-10-07 19:10:33 +03:00
Vadim Godunko
98b999e2a8 V805-018 Decoder of ISO-8859-9 2022-10-07 19:10:33 +03:00
Vadim Godunko
874d7881aa V805-018 Decoder of ISO-8859-8 2022-10-07 19:10:33 +03:00
Vadim Godunko
7702be6ab5 V805-018 Decoder of ISO-8859-7 2022-10-07 19:10:33 +03:00
Vadim Godunko
7be19b3a1c V805-018 Decoder of ISO-8859-6 2022-10-07 19:10:33 +03:00
Vadim Godunko
6242ba1ced V805-018 Decoder of ISO-8859-5 2022-10-07 19:10:33 +03:00